The main idea of the game is that you place a bet on what is referred to as the “passline bet”. All bets have to be made before the dice are rolled. The dice are rolled and if the total is 7 or 11 you win. If the total is any other number except 7,11,12,3,2 this number is called a point number. In the case of a point number this number has to be rolled again before 7 , if it happens you win. You lose if 7 is rolled first. There is one more bet available for Craps players. Martingale system
Such games as craps can't be beaten by the system. But there are players who believe in it. The Martingale System is one of the best known systems. The player doubles his bet when he loses. He starts over at the initial amount when he wins. To save an amount equal to the initial amount after every eventual win is the idea. The player can be out of money doubling his bet several times. The casino can also not allow to bet the huge amount dictated by the system. A profit equal to the initial bet amount is kept every time the player wins.

The Iron Cross
The Iron Cross bet allows to win on every roll that is not a seven. The Iron Cross is a field bet and place bets on the 5, 6 and 8. This strategy will not create a mathematical advantage for the player.
Gambler's fallacy
Past dice rolls are believed to influence the probabilities of future dice rolls. In reality, each roll of the dice is an independent event. The probability of rolling an eleven is exactly 1/18 on every roll.

Dice setting or dice control
This system presupposes throwing the dice in a special manner. The theory is that certain numbers are more likely to be shown. Steps are taken to prevent this. The dice are required to hit the back wall of the table. It helps to make the controll of the spins more difficult.
